#YouAsked Health How many people die from malaria in Nigeria in a year? Source Severe Malaria Observatory: Nigeria Short answer How many people die from malaria in Nigeria in a year? In 2021, Nigeria had the highest number of global malaria cases, accounting for 26.6% of global cases, and the highest number of malaria deaths, accounting for 31% of global malaria deaths. Health What proportion of Kenyan children under five are stunted? Source Global Nutrition Report 2022: The burden of malnutrition at a glance Short answer What proportion of Kenyan children under five are stunted? In Kenya, 26.2% of children under the age of five are stunted. This rate is considered lower than the African regional average of 30.7%. #YouAsked Education What is the literacy rate in Zimbabwe? Source Population and housing census preliminary results on education 2022 Short answer What is the literacy rate in Zimbabwe? A preliminary education survey by the Zimbabwe National Statistics Agency (ZimStat), as part of the 2022 population and housing census, indicates a literacy rate of 93.7% in 2022, down from 96% in 2012. ... Education How many universities are there in Africa? Source Uniranks - Africa University Rankings Short answer How many universities are there in Africa? As of 2023, there are 2,389 universities in Africa according to the UniRanks Africa University Rankings.
